Use Secure Engine on LS1043A for Security boot and cryptography

c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 

Use Secure Engine on LS1043A for Security boot and cryptography

464 Views
Xiaomingtang
Contributor I

Hello,

I want use the secure engine hardware on LS1043A for AES and RNG. There is CAAM driver in the Linux Kernel, which provide access to the hardware via DMA. My problem is I want use it in the stand alone image, like boot loader and Uboot, which doesn't have Linux OS.  Does anyone know is there is stand alone lib code or Can I use and link Caam driver code directly with Uboot code? 

Thanks.

Xiaoming

0 Kudos
2 Replies

458 Views
Xiaomingtang
Contributor I

Is it possible to use Caam code with no or mini modification? Like calling the caam_jr_init() in jr.c  to init hardware.

0 Kudos

460 Views
ufedor
NXP Employee
NXP Employee

Currently there is no such library.

Please consider using payed NXP Professional Engineering Services:

https://contact.nxp.com/ps2019

0 Kudos